Transaction 7c57710c33e93a202676659249ed296141b9a12b886d0264c33588e77f09d3b8
1 Input
1 Output
-
7c57710c33e93a202676659249ed296141b9a12b886d0264c33588e77f09d3b8:0
- value
- 173294
- script pubkey
- OP_0 OP_PUSHBYTES_32 3c2c9a3022ad5a04f506cbfe06e144e27dfe6f9140df384d5eb0f06c12c4380f
- address
- bc1q8skf5vpz44dqfagxe0lqdc2yuf7lumu3gr0nsn27krcxcyky8q8sdhudnd